Sedalia Visual Art Association Members’ Exhibition

May 28 - August 21, 2011

Free

A celebration of diverse artworks by members of Sedalia’s oldest visual arts organization. SVAA’s members are award-winning artists from throughout west-central Missouri. Selections range from paintings and watercolors, drawings and photographs, to sculptural objects in clay and metal.

2011 Annual Student Exhibition

April 14 - May 8, 2011

Free

The annual student exhibition, a State Fair Community College tradition dating back to the late 1960s, is open to all students currently taking studio art classes at the college. Douglass Freed, Paintings, 1973-2010

February 5 - May 29, 2011

Free

This retrospective traces the evolution of a body of work that has consistently explored issues of abstraction, suggestion, surface, and deep space. The survey ranges from large-scale monochromatic color fields to more structured arrangements inspired by the archeology of Greece and Mexico.
